The glass. The bread and butter around Wanstead Flats is terrace glass: Victorian bays, sash uppers on the older runs, uPVC replacements on the rest. Bays collect road film fast, so a four-weekly cycle genuinely shows here — the glass is grey by week five and the neighbours notice whose isn't. 323 completions in a year is stay-put territory, and households that settle keep the same cleaner on the same week of the month for years on end.

The parking. Controlled zones shape the whole working day in E7; fighting them is a hobby, planning around them is a business. Learn the zone hours: many go free after half five, and the smart rounds shift their tightest streets to the edges of the day. The water in this part of the country runs hard, which is exactly why water-fed poles here feed on purified water — used straight from the tap it would dry to a film of mineral spotting on every pane.
